The Graduate Certificate in Ensuring Responsible Academic Conduct is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to promote academic integrity and prevent plagiarism in various academic settings.
This program focuses on teaching students how to identify and address instances of academic misconduct, as well as how to develop and implement effective policies and procedures to prevent such behavior. By the end of the program, students will be able to analyze complex academic issues, develop well-supported arguments, and communicate effectively with colleagues and stakeholders.
The duration of the Graduate Certificate in Ensuring Responsible Academic Conduct is typically one year, consisting of four courses that are designed to be completed over a period of 12 months. The program is highly relevant to industries such as education, research, and publishing, where academic integrity is of paramount importance.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to apply knowledge of academic integrity principles and practices to real-world scenarios, as well as the ability to design and implement effective policies and procedures to prevent academic misconduct. Students will also be able to analyze and evaluate the effectiveness of existing policies and procedures, and develop strategies for promoting a culture of academic integrity within their organizations.
